Output cc629f5e6e867664f55c96a438f5c80205ce727073b3686fdc0ae6d50337f53e:0

value
31214865
script pubkey
OP_0 OP_PUSHBYTES_20 de70fb9042994bcff5662ae87b5c7777f9ab3a7e
address
bc1qmec0hyzzn99ulatx9t58khrhwlu6kwn7cmn6dg
transaction
cc629f5e6e867664f55c96a438f5c80205ce727073b3686fdc0ae6d50337f53e